The Future of Medical Bed Factories Innovation in Healthcare


In recent years, the importance of medical beds in healthcare settings has been underscored by their critical role in patient care. As the demand for advanced healthcare solutions continues to rise, the spotlight has increasingly turned towards medical bed factories, where innovation and technology converge to improve patient experiences and outcomes.


Medical beds are no longer just traditional hospital beds; they have evolved into sophisticated pieces of medical equipment equipped with various features that cater to the diverse needs of patients. From electrical adjustments that allow for multiple sleeping positions to integrated monitoring systems that assist healthcare professionals in tracking patients’ vital signs, the modern medical bed is a marvel of engineering and design.

Furthermore, customization has become a vital aspect of medical bed manufacturing. Each patient has unique needs based on their medical condition, age, and personal preferences. Medical bed factories are now equipped to offer tailor-made solutions, allowing for adjustable features such as height, tilt, and support systems that can be modified to suit individual patient requirements. This level of personalization not only enhances comfort but also plays a crucial role in the recovery process, as studies have shown that patient comfort can significantly influence healing.

Another noteworthy trend in medical bed factories is the integration of smart technology. Smart beds are on the rise, incorporating IoT (Internet of Things) capabilities that enable real-time monitoring of a patient’s condition. These beds can alert medical staff if a patient is at risk of falling or requires assistance, which can drastically reduce response times and improve patient safety. Moreover, data collected from these smart beds can be analyzed to identify patterns that help healthcare professionals make informed decisions about patient care.


Sustainability is also becoming a key consideration in medical bed manufacturing. Factories are increasingly seeking environmentally friendly materials and processes to reduce their carbon footprint. This includes using recyclable materials, implementing energy-efficient manufacturing practices, and minimizing waste through lean manufacturing techniques. By adopting sustainable practices, medical bed factories not only contribute to a healthier planet but also appeal to healthcare providers who are increasingly prioritizing eco-friendly products.
